循环和网络抓取是指通过编程实现自动化地从网络上获取多个元素的过程。下面是关于循环和网络抓取的完善且全面的答案:
循环和网络抓取: 循环和网络抓取是指通过编程技术实现自动化地从网络上获取多个元素的过程。循环是指重复执行某个操作的过程,而网络抓取则是指从互联网上获取数据的过程。循环和网络抓取通常结合使用,通过循环来遍历多个网页或者多个元素,并使用网络抓取技术从中提取所需的数据。
如何抓取多个元素: 要抓取多个元素,可以使用编程语言中的网络抓取库或者框架,如Python中的Requests、BeautifulSoup、Scrapy等。以下是一个示例代码,演示如何使用Python和BeautifulSoup库来抓取多个元素:
import requests
from bs4 import BeautifulSoup
# 发送HTTP请求,获取网页内容
response = requests.get('https://example.com')
# 使用BeautifulSoup解析网页内容
soup = BeautifulSoup(response.text, 'html.parser')
# 使用CSS选择器定位多个元素
elements = soup.select('.element-class')
# 遍历多个元素并提取数据
for element in elements:
# 提取元素的文本内容
text = element.text
print(text)
在上述示例中,首先使用requests库发送HTTP请求,获取网页的内容。然后使用BeautifulSoup库解析网页内容,并使用CSS选择器定位多个元素。最后,通过循环遍历多个元素,并提取所需的数据。
循环和网络抓取的应用场景: 循环和网络抓取在云计算领域和IT互联网领域有广泛的应用场景,包括但不限于以下几个方面:
腾讯云相关产品和产品介绍链接地址: 腾讯云提供了多个与循环和网络抓取相关的产品和服务,以下是其中几个常用的产品和对应的介绍链接地址:
请注意,以上仅为示例产品,腾讯云还提供了更多与循环和网络抓取相关的产品和服务,具体可根据实际需求进行选择和使用。
领取专属 10元无门槛券
手把手带您无忧上云